    aboriginal tourismaboriginal tourism

    Market research has recently assessed awareness of Aboriginal tourism among overseas visitors to Australia. Europe, led by Germany, has emerged as the strongest market for Aboriginal tourism. German tourists are the most likely to travel to the Australian outback. While 35% of German tourists made a trip to the outback, only 5% of Japanese tourists visited the outback in 1999-2000. About 80% of German tourists ·strongly agreed· or ·agreed· that Australia offered very interesting cultural experiences. Visitors from European countries generally indicated a high level of interest and knowledge about Indigenous culture. In a recent survey of potential Chinese visitors, 39% expressed interest in Indigenous cultural products.

    Significantly, 37% of international visitors expressing high or medium interest in Aboriginal tourism left Australia without participating in an Aboriginal tourism experience, according to the Survey of Indigenous Tourism 2000. The report, which focuses on expectations of Aboriginal tourism experiences, satisfaction, conversion and identifying target markets, notes that reasons for this include time constraints and inability to find the appropriate information.

    Aboriginal Tourism Australia has adopted a broader description of Aboriginal tourism which encompasses four distinct but related elements. Aboriginal tourism is:

    • concerned with cultural and biological diversity
    • asserts prior informed participation of all stakeholders, and active decision-making processes accorded to Indigenous and local communities
    • recognises Indigenous persons· special connection to land and waters
    • recognises customary proprietary knowledge held on a community and individual basis.

    Message from Cathy Freeman, ambassador for ATA and Olympic gold medalist, 2000

    "As the Ambassador for Aboriginal Tourism Australia I am pleased to have the opportunity to promote Australia’s Indigenous cultures to the world.

    I am a proud Australian who has much pride in my Aboriginal heritage. I was especially proud when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ander culture was showcased to a global audience at the opening ceremony of the Sydney 2000 Olympics. The richness and diversity of Australia’s Indigenous cultures were beamed to billions of viewers around the world and I was immensely proud that I could claim a heritage that dates back more than 40,000 years.

    Tourism offers so much to both Aboriginal communities and visitors. For visitors there is the chance to meet Indigenous people and learn about us as a people and to learn about our spiritual beliefs that connects each clan to the land. For Aboriginal communities tourism provides the opportunity for involvement in the real economy and enables our young people to stay on country. It provides the opportunity for Aboriginal people to share their intimate knowledge of the landscape with tourists.

    Aboriginal people are pleased to share our knowledge and beliefs with visitors all that is asked is respect. Remember the ‘Three Rs’, Relationship, Responsibility and Respect. Whilst you may not understand, we ask that you respect Indigenous people’s beliefs."

    • Gary Pappin mycountryenterprises: Specialised tours in the Willandra Lakes World Heritage Area, The Willandra Lakes World Heritage Area, including Lake Mungo National Park, covers 240,000 hectares of a semi-arid mosaic landscape of interconnected dry lakes. Crowned by lunettes large enough to be seen from space, the lakes bear witness to extensive human occupation for more than 40,000 years.My Country Enterprises offers exclusive access to the entire World Heritage Area. Discover this unique cultural and physical landscape with the expertise, hospitality and knowledge of its Indigenous People.
